Most traffic crimes are infractions and the person is left of with a warning or fine. Infractions can add points to your license and once you get too many points on your driving record, or in some cases when the violations are extreme in nature, the courts or the DMV can suspend or revoke your driver’s license. However, a traffic crime becomes a misdemeanor or felony if it causes injury to a person or destruction of property, or creates a real threat of injury to a person or destruction of property. The penalties for a misdemeanor or felony traffic offense are severe and if convicted, you can be sent to prison.
